Nancy Elaine Beissel, 76, passed away unexpectantly surrounded by family on Thursday, June 13, 2024 at Penn State Health St. Joseph Medical Center. She was the loving wife of William Harold Beissel, Jr. They were celebrating their 58th wedding anniversary just two days prior to her passing.
Born in Shoemakersville, she was a daughter of the late George and Florence (Moyer) Yeager. After graduating Schuylkill Valley High School in 1965, Nancy worked diligently as a sewing machine operator for Wright's Knitwear for many years. More recently, she worked in housekeeping at the Reading Hospital until her retirement. Above all, she was devoted to her family and dearly loved by many. Being a wife, mother, and Grammy were her most important roles. Nancy was a great friend, listener, and confidant. She loved joking around and having fun. Nancy truly was a blessing to all who knew her.
In addition to her husband, Bill, Nancy is survived by her son, William H. Beissel III, husband of Wendy; daughter, Karen Raugh, wife of Andrew; grandchildren: Megan Beissel, Brittany Emmel (husband Thayer) and Derek Anderson (partner Tommy Malek); great grandson, Dominic Emmel; sisters: Mary Lou Berger (husband of the late Robert), Doris Rismiller (husband Gary), and Faye Luckenbill; brothers: Norman Yeager, Thomas Yeager (wife Susan), Richard Yeager (wife Amy) and David Yeager (wife Hilda), and many nieces and nephews. Nancy always enjoyed being with her family. She always looked forward to family get togethers and spending time with loved ones. Nancy could often be seen enjoying breakfast with her family at the Centerport Fire Company where in the summer she volunteered to make sandwiches for their fundraisers for many years.
Nancy loved her cats. She took care of her indoor cats as well as outdoor cats. She also doted on her grandkitties. Nancy enjoyed driving her "antique" Trailblazer and driving it to various destinations. She was also fond of "playing on her phone," reading, and working on her puzzle books.
